Hi,
I want to copy a catalog item but there is no Copy button but has Insert button on Catalog Item form as stated in following document:
Copying can be more useful than using the Insert function because the function only copies the item details.
Procedure
- Open a catalog item form.
- Use the Copy button to create a new copy of a catalog item, named Copy of [item name]
Please help.

The Copy button will not display if the catalog item is in state Draft or Publishing state or is Checked Out. Can you verify that none of the above is true for you?
